Did you know that there is a spa cuisine concept? This cuisine involves the most seasonally appropriate natural ingredients, the highest quality ingredients with nutritional value, balanced portions, low calorie foods, flavors that are dominated by creativity and originality, heartwarming colors and aromas.
It also touches upon healthy nutrition and detox methods such as “raw food”, ayurvedic, macrobiotic nutrition and fasting. In this article we listed 3 practical recipes that are in spa menus. It is time to reinforce our creativity with healthy recipes.
Rancho La Puearta’s eggless recipe invites you to a sweet journey in Mexico, one of cacao’s origin countries. This journey starts with the sourishness of chocolate and continues with the tropical touches of appealing coconut.

First add the coconut milk and sugar into a bowl over medium heat. Keep on stirring for around 2 minutes until the sugar dissolves and the mixture thickens. Put the heat on low, add the sliced chocolate and the pinch of salt and stir again until the chocolate melts. Pour the mixture into cups and place them in the refrigerator for at least 20 minutes, or until it reaches the consistency of a pudding. In the meantime, in a small pan toast coconut flake over medium heat. Wait until they cool down and one you take out the puddings sprinkle over them. You can do some finishing touches with fresh fruit and mint leaves.
This delicious cocktail Chiva Som, is prepared using a series of healthy ingredients. While apples and beets rich in vitamin C help stop common colds, the beet also helps lower blood pressure and plays an antioxidant role in improving general cardiovascular health. And ginger that provides important benefits to the digestive system helps eliminate inflammation and improves antioxidant enzyme functions.

Juice the ingredients, pour into a glass and serve. If you would like to consume it cold, you can pre-cool the glass or you can add big ice cubes to prevent them from watering down the juice.
This light and energizing salad recipe from Kamalaya Koh Samui, supports the natural detox process of the body. It contributes to liver health by containing raw and healthy components rich in calcium, fiber and iron, as well as vitamins A, K and C.

Put all the ingredients in a bowl and mix slowly. After letting it rest for around 3 – 5 minutes you can create a magnificent appearance by adding capia pepper and edible flowers on top to decorate.
